Russell sits in St. Lawrence County, deep in New York's North Country, where the Adirondack foothills give way to open farmland and the landscape carries a rugged, unhurried character. This is a part of the state most golfers from the city never reach, which is precisely what makes the region worth the detour — wide skies, genuine quiet, and a pace of life that tends to rub off on a round.
Blueberry Hill is the kind of 18-hole, par-72 layout that serves as the anchor of its local golf community. Courses like this one exist because people in the area love the game and built something to call their own — they tend to reward local knowledge, reflect the natural contours of the land around them, and offer a straightforward, honest round without pretense.
St. Lawrence County's short warm season means the golf here is vivid when it arrives — lush, green, and genuinely appreciated by the players who make it out. Expect a welcoming atmosphere and a course that earns its place in a region that doesn't have many to spare.
| Tee | Yards | Rating | Slope | Par |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Blue · men | 6,716 | 71.8 | 123 | 72 |
| White · men | 6,428 | 70.5 | 119 | 72 |
| White · women | 6,428 | 76.5 | 131 | 73 |
| Gold · women | 5,482 | 71.5 | 120 | 73 |
| Gold · men | 5,381 | 66.7 | 113 | 72 |
